Qing-Hao Li is a scholar working on Food Science,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ment. According to data from OpenAlex, Qing-Hao Li has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 354 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Food Science, 3 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 3 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ment. Recurrent topics in Qing-Hao Li's work include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(3 papers), Proteins in Food Systems (3 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(2 papers). Qing-Hao Li is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(3 papers), Proteins in Food Systems (3 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(2 papers). Qing-Hao Li collaborates with scholars based in China, Singapore and United States. Qing-Hao Li's co-authors include Yuqian Cui, Yun‐Ze Long, Xiaoxiong Wang, Min Dong, Ru Li, Xiqian Yu, Jienan Zhang, Hong Li, Guoqing Huang and Jun‐Xia Xiao and has published in prestigious journals such as Carbohydrate Polymers, The Journal of Physical Chemistry Letters and Journal of Materials Science.
